-
Notifications
You must be signed in to change notification settings - Fork 5.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
day 2 tasks performed #301
base: master
Are you sure you want to change the base?
day 2 tasks performed #301
Conversation
WalkthroughA new document named Changes
Poem
Thank you for using CodeRabbit. We offer it for free to the OSS community and would appreciate your support in helping us grow. If you find it useful, would you consider giving us a shout-out on your favorite social media? 🪧 TipsChatThere are 3 ways to chat with CodeRabbit:
Note: Be mindful of the bot's finite context window. It's strongly recommended to break down tasks such as reading entire modules into smaller chunks. For a focused discussion, use review comments to chat about specific files and their changes, instead of using the PR comments. CodeRabbit Commands (Invoked using PR comments)
Other keywords and placeholders
CodeRabbit Configuration File (
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Actionable comments posted: 0
🧹 Outside diff range and nitpick comments (3)
2024/day02/linux_day_2_solution.md (3)
15-20
: Add language specifier to fenced code blockThe output for the
ls -l
command is presented in a fenced code block. To improve syntax highlighting and adhere to Markdown best practices, consider adding a language specifier to the code block.Apply this change:
- ``` + ```shell total 4 drwxrwxr-x 3 ubuntu ubuntu 4096 Oct 6 05:59 devops<details> <summary>🧰 Tools</summary> <details> <summary>🪛 Markdownlint</summary><blockquote> 16-16: null Fenced code blocks should have a language specified (MD040, fenced-code-language) </blockquote></details> </details> --- `44-46`: **Clarify the explanation for `cd basic/`** The current explanation for `cd basic/` is not entirely accurate as it assumes the existence of a `wordlife` directory, which is not mentioned in the command or its context. Consider updating the explanation to: ```diff - **Explanation:** Changes the current directory to `basic` within `wordlife`. + **Explanation:** Changes the current directory to a subdirectory named `basic` in the current directory.
74-82
: Consider expanding the directory navigation sectionWhile the current content is accurate, this section could benefit from additional examples and explanations to provide a more comprehensive overview of directory navigation.
Consider adding the following examples:
- Using absolute paths:
cd /home/username/projects
- Navigating to the home directory:
cd ~
or simplycd
- Using environment variables:
cd $HOME/documents
These additions would provide a more rounded understanding of directory navigation in Linux.
Would you like me to draft the content for these additional examples?
📜 Review details
Configuration used: CodeRabbit UI
Review profile: CHILL
📒 Files selected for processing (1)
- 2024/day02/linux_day_2_solution.md (1 hunks)
🧰 Additional context used
🪛 Markdownlint
2024/day02/linux_day_2_solution.md
16-16: null
Fenced code blocks should have a language specified(MD040, fenced-code-language)
🔇 Additional comments (3)
2024/day02/linux_day_2_solution.md (3)
1-7
: LGTM: Clear and concise introductionThe introduction effectively sets the context for the document, explaining its purpose and relation to the #90DaysofDevOps challenge.
60-72
: LGTM: Comprehensive coverage of directory creation commandsThis section effectively covers various
mkdir
commands, including creating multiple directories, subdirectories, and nested structures. The explanations are clear and accurate.
1-82
: Overall: Well-structured and informative Linux command guideThis document provides a comprehensive introduction to basic Linux commands, covering essential topics such as listing files and directories, working with directories, creating directories, and navigating the directory structure. The explanations are clear and the examples are practical.
For future enhancements, consider:
- Adding a table of contents for easier navigation.
- Including a section on file manipulation commands (e.g.,
cp
,mv
,rm
).- Adding examples of combining commands using pipes and redirections.
Great work on creating this helpful resource for the #90DaysofDevOps challenge!
🧰 Tools
🪛 Markdownlint
16-16: null
Fenced code blocks should have a language specified(MD040, fenced-code-language)
Summary by CodeRabbit